Additional peculiarities of the municipality:
Lanchyn municipality located in the foothills of the Carpathian Mountains, on a vital transport corridor with easy access to the H-09 highway, providing excellent logistics links across western Ukraine and towards EU borders.
The economy of the municipality is driven by wood processing, retail, and agriculture, with natural conditions that are ideal for growing industrial crops like flax. Natural assets include the Prut River, large mixed forests, and a unique cascade of 12 ponds that offers fantastic opportunities for commercial fish farming and eco-tourism.
